Transaction e28d62df78f060c9ac4e23aa4b75512cb51f199ed2a394181588b1612b83a697
1 Input
1 Output
-
e28d62df78f060c9ac4e23aa4b75512cb51f199ed2a394181588b1612b83a697:0
- value
- 39207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c97a6371cbc1c88293881de1e6f3ae671bd451b OP_EQUAL
- address
- 3BbCa3ABK4KzD7j4RAd6eKkc8qUCryLgF8